I am new babe with soft PBX and 3CX. I made up my trunk and route correctly I think. I want to dial 9+phone number, and calls go through my VOIP provider trunk. Looks like the provider trunk is registered correctly and call routed correctly with stripping of 1st "9". But it fails everytime. why? Btw, if I put the same SIP setting directly into my IP phone with dial same number it works.

found the problem. Through line by line comparison between my IP phone and 3CX Trunk.

All my VOIP providers here only support G729 codec. I am using a free 3CX, so no G729 is provided. I have to forget 3CX now, and I am not going to pay couple hundreds euro just for G729. I am going to switch to Elastrix as I can pay 10$ per G729 license, and the software is completely free.
